logo

Output 51c0bd23d5e4e059f28b6f268cfe2f00718ef036dc99f3e412c91ac7077a692d:1

value
2681419
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d5b927ece545a5e5bb7a220cbe3e8be8ea78a0 OP_EQUALVERIFY OP_CHECKSIG
address
1KDdVvmfnABCQq6JHBYv5szcJkLJ5LuPtv
transaction
51c0bd23d5e4e059f28b6f268cfe2f00718ef036dc99f3e412c91ac7077a692d